350sf and 625sf cells growing in serum free medium secrete transforming growth factors (TGFs) that induce NIH 3T3 indicator cells to form colonies in soft agar. The addition of 2 ng/ml of EGF increases twice the number of colonies of NIH 3T3 indicator cells. The TGFs secreted by 350sf and 625 sf cells do not compete with 125I EGF for binding to EGF receptors on human A-431 cells. The number of EGF receptors on 350 sf and 625 sf and 625 sf cells continuously grown in serum-free medium do not differ from that of EGF receptors on parental Lebr-350 and Lebr-625 cells continuously grown in the presence of 10% serum. These results suggest that TGFs produced by 350 sf and 625 sf cells are not alpha TGF. It is possible that cells secrete beta TGFs of yet unknown type.

Lebr 625 and Lebr 350 cells, resistant to ethidium bromide in concentrations 25 and 50 mkg/ml, are able to grow continuously in serum- and protein-free media. Under the same conditions the parental L929 cells are not able to. Two cell lines (625 sf and 350 sf) were established capable of growing in serum- and protein free media. It is found that ethidium bromide is toxic for resistant cells grown the in serum-free medium. The addition of serum lowers the toxic action of ethidium bromide. A continuous growth of resistant cells in serum-free medium (under nonselective conditions) leads to a decreased level of resistance, which may nevertheless persist for a long period of cultivation (over 2.5 years).

Cation fluxes and intracellular content in mouse fibroblasts L, growing for more than three years in the Dulbecco modified Eagle's serum-free medium (clone L625sf) were measured as a function of culture density. The cells show no density-dependent inhibition of growth and in continuously growing cultures of L625sf cells internal potassium, and rubidium influx was found to remain high within a wide range of densities (5.10(4)-20.10(4) cells/cm2). A close correlation was revealed between the potassium transport and the proliferative state of L625sf cultures: the addition of 5% calf serum to logarithmically growing cultures leads to the increase in culture growth rate as well as to the increase in ouabain-inhibited rubidium influx and intracellular potassium content; a delay in culture growth rate due to medium depletion is accompanied by decreasing both the rubidium influx and the intracellular potassium content. It is concluded that L625sf cells being capable of multiplicating in serum-free medium remain sensitive to growth factors of serum and may be used for study of growth factor induction of cell proliferation and for identification of autocrine factors of cell growth.

The content of cholesterol (Chl) and phospholipids (Phl) in cell lines L and CHO-K1, sensitive and resistant to the toxic action of ethidium bromide, has been studied. EB-resistant cells were shown to have lower amounts of Chl and Phl, and the ratio Chl/Phl in these cells was decreased too. EB-resistant cells, grown in serum-free medium, have dramatically decreased contents of Chl, while compared with the cells growing with serum. Treatment of EB-resistant cells with methyltestosterone in concentration of 3 X 10(-7) M caused the increase in Chl and Phl contents, thus approximating these indices to those of EB-sensitive ones.

A study was made of the ouabain effect (10(-3] on cell proliferation and the dependence of ATP hydrolysis on Na/K-concentration in homogenates of mouse hepatoma (XXIIa) and of L-cells, both sensitive and resistant to etidium bromide. Na+, K+-ATPase activity was found in homogenates of cells from sparse cultures in the presence of ouabain, the activity being stimulated by the Na/K-ratio pecular for the maximum enzymatic activity in cells from the dense cultures. The effect of ouabain on the cell proliferation is similar to the effect of transition of sparse cultures to dense ones.

A considerable increase in the level of cyclic adenosine monophosphate (cAMP) was found in hepatoma cultures (clones G-10, G-1c) and L-cells (clones Lebr 625, Lebr f. s.) in 30, 60 and 120 minutes after their treatment with the tumor promoter 12-o-tetradecanoyl-phorbol-13-acetate (TPA). In the mutant cells with changed membranes (clones G-1c, Lebr 625, Lebr 625 f. s.) the rising of cAMP was less expressed under the influence of TPA. The contents of cAMP decreases to the control level by 22 hours after their TPA treatment. A consequence of biochemical changes, leading to the tumor growth after TPA treatment of the cells, has been proposed. A considerable increment in cAMP amount is supposed to be a trigger in this chain.

RNA metabolism at 1-, 2- and 8-celled stages was studied in C3H and C57Bl mice by means of detection of RNA content in individual embryos and microcolumnal chromatography of lysate of the embryos labelled with 3H-uridine. The increase of RNA content in the 8-celled embryos of the both strains is due to active synthesis of high and low molecular weight RNAs during this period. A comparison of 3H-uridine incorporation in RNA, and nucleotide fractions of 2-celled embryos has shown that the embryonic genome per se is activated earlier in C3H mice. The embryonic development and RNA changes in them are similar in the pure bred and hybrid embryos with common mothers. This serves as an additional evidence of the leading role of maternal factors in embryonic development during the first cleavage divisions.
